Chaykin didn’t really make single page spreads very often. This is just barely part of the two-page spread because of that tiny sliver of image on the far right edge.
I really like how he handled the couch – just a bunch of jumbled lines until it needed to be a defined couch. And the shot of the alien city is reminiscent of the space propaganda that hippie rocket scientists like Bernal produced.
(Heavy Metal issue #53, August 1981 – Page 86 Cody Starbuck by Chaykin)
